Real Men, Real Setbacks, Real Comebacks
1. Robert Downey Jr. – From Addiction to Iron Man
Robert Downey Jr. spent years battling drug addiction, arrests, and public humiliation. Hollywood blacklisted him. He could have been a tragic “what could have been.” Instead, he got clean, rebuilt his reputation, and went on to star as Iron Man, becoming one of the most successful actors in history. His story proves that overcoming setbacks in life—even after extreme lows—is possible.
2. Nelson Mandela – From Prisoner to President
Mandela was falsely accused, imprisoned for 27 years, and robbed of the prime of his life. Yet when he walked free, he chose forgiveness over bitterness. He rebuilt not only his own life but also an entire nation. His example shows that setbacks—even unjust ones—don’t define the ending.
3. Dwayne “The Rock” Johnson – From Rejection to Wrestling Legend
At 23, The Rock’s dream of being an NFL player ended in rejection. He had only $7 to his name. Instead of giving up, he pivoted, entered professional wrestling, and eventually became a global icon in movies, business, and fitness. His story is a masterclass in overcoming setbacks in life by turning rejection into redirection.
4. Steve Jobs – From Fired to Founder Again
Jobs was fired from Apple—the company he created. The humiliation could have ended him. But he kept building, launching Pixar and NeXT, before returning to Apple to revolutionize the tech world. His setback was the setup for his greatest comeback.

7 Steps to Overcoming Setbacks in Life After 35
1. Face Reality Without Shame
Acknowledge what happened. Failure, rejection, or accusations don’t define your worth. They are chapters, not your whole book.
2. Find a Mentor or Coach
Every great comeback story involves guidance. Men who try to “go it alone” often stay stuck. A coach, therapist, or mentor can guide you through the fog.
3. Rebuild Your Health First
Exercise, sleep, and diet are not optional. Physical strength fuels mental strength. Start with small steps, like walking daily.
4. Reframe Failure as Feedback
Ask: What did this setback teach me? Robert Downey Jr. used prison as a wake-up call. The Rock used rejection as redirection. You can do the same.
5. Reconstruct Your Identity
Who do you want to become now? Divorce, addiction, or false accusations may have taken away old labels. But you get to define your future.
6. Build a Support Tribe
Isolation is poison. Surround yourself with men who challenge you, inspire you, and sharpen you—iron sharpens iron.
7. Take Consistent Small Steps Forward
Grand comebacks are built on small daily wins. Commit to one habit each week—saving money, exercising, learning, or reconnecting with family.
